Our first step is coming up with our idea. We suggest you start with something completely new for this challenge, as you’ll get the most out of it. An idea is the foundation of the writing process, but we also need to make sure it’s the right idea. For that, we’re going to need options.
A great exercise from the StoryCraft Workbook is called Crazy 8s. To give it a try, draw a grid of eight squares on a piece of paper and set a timer for ten minutes. Then, in each square, write a new idea for a novel. Try to get as many different ideas as possible so you have some interesting choices.
The point of this exercise is to put your creative brain into a rapidly flowing stream of ideas so you can find not just an idea, but the best possible idea for this next book.
